Nettes knock off 2A #2 Sundown in OT, 47-45

The Sudan Nettes’ varsity basketball team picked up a huge win on the road in overtime on Friday night, as they knocked off 2A #2 Sundown, 47-45.

With the win, the Nettes improve to 8-7 overall on the season.

Sudan jumped out to a small lead in the first quarter, 17-13, and outscored the Roughettes, 13-5, in the second frame to take a, 3018, lead into the locker room at halftime.

Sundown, though, would not go away, as they outscored the Nettes, 8-6, in the third quarter, and, 16-6, in the fourth quarter to tie the game, 42-42, forcing overtime.

In the extra period, Sudan outscored the Roughettes, 5-3, to take the contest, 47-45.

Stevi Lockhart led the team in scoring with 23 points, to go along with six rebounds, two steals, one assist and one block, while Gracyn Shultz tallied nine points, six rebounds, two blocks, two assists and one steal. Blessy Montes chipped in four points, two rebounds, two steals and one assist, while Braelyn Pointer contributed, four points, seven rebounds, six steals, one assist and one block.

Landree Gonzales added three points and two blocks, while Edette Herrera contributed two points, three steals and two assists, and Elaine Martinez added two points, four rebounds and one assist. Melo Rodriguez chipped in two rebounds and one steal, while Kambry Tolbert finished with six rebounds, one steal and one block.

The Nettes opened district play on Tuesday at Lockney. Results were not available at press time. They will continue their season on Friday with a district contest against Floydada in Sudan.
